Island hood filters are a vital part of the overall performance of your range hood, and you will need to change them on a routine basis to make sure that the hood continues to carry out appropriately. Grease can develop up on the filter, causing it to end up being obstructed and even to start dripping onto the range and counter tops. Cleaning the filter regularly helps to keep it in excellent condition. There are numerous various kinds of hood filters, consisting of stainless steel baffle filters that trap grease particles mechanically and are dishwashing machine safe. You can also get reusable charcoal filters that require to be cleaned every 2-3 months. These filters are typically less expensive and can be utilized with ducted or recirculating island hoods. For a more eco-friendly option, you can likewise buy a ceramic filter that uses extremely high filtering and deodorization efficiency levels and requires regular heat regrowth to keep it in excellent condition. Nevertheless, it's best to seek advice from the manufacturer of your hood to find out which type of filter is the most proper for it.
